@WidenerMVB Upended by Rutgers-Newark

CHESTER, Pa. – The Widener University men's volleyball team was upended in a non-conference match on Wednesday by the Rutgers-Newark Scarlet Raiders 3-0.
 
HIGHIGHTS
  • A.J. Sungenis led Widener with seven kills in the match and also notched an ace.
  • Billy Barclay topped the Pride with 15 assists.
  • Kyle Minder made the most of his swings with four kills in five attacks.
 
FIRST SET NOTES (11-25)
  • The Blue and Gold started the set well, going up 3-1 on kills by Sungenis, Wil Cacciatore and an ace by Sungenis.
  • Still close at 6-5 RU, the Scarlet Raiders scored 11 unanswered to take control of the set.
  • Kyle Minder and Sungenis led the Pride with three kills each in the set with both hitting better than .350. Minder had his trio of kills in as many attempts.
  • Widener hit a respectable. 174 in the frame.
 
SECOND SET NOTES (7-25)
  • The Pride remained in shouting distance early in the set, trailing 11-6 before a 14-1 run capped the set for Rutgers-Newark
  • Sungenis took the lead in the set with a pair of kills.
 
THIRD SET NOTES (14-25)
  • The Scarlet Raiders started strong, opening a 7-2 lead before Widener rallied back to 9-6 on a kill be Cacciatore.
  • Faced with match point, Matt Blaum stepped up for the Blue and Gold, coming up with a kill and a service ace.
  • Sungenis and Cacciatore had two kills each for the Pride and Barclay recorded six assists.
